发布时间2025-04-06 21:42
在当今信息化时代,CDN直播技术已经成为网络直播的主流。然而,网络波动对画质的影响一直是困扰直播行业的一大难题。本文将深入探讨CDN直播如何应对网络波动对画质的影响,为您揭示其中的奥秘。
一、CDN直播与网络波动
CDN(内容分发网络)是一种通过在多个地理位置部署服务器,实现内容快速分发的技术。在直播领域,CDN可以将直播内容分发到全球各地的服务器上,从而提高直播的流畅性和画质。
网络波动是指网络传输过程中,带宽、延迟、丢包等参数的变化。网络波动对画质的影响主要体现在以下三个方面:
(1)带宽波动:带宽波动会导致画面卡顿、分辨率降低等问题。
(2)延迟波动:延迟波动会导致画面与实际时间不一致,影响观感。
(3)丢包波动:丢包波动会导致画面出现马赛克、断裂等现象。
二、CDN直播应对网络波动的方法
CDN直播采用智能选路技术,根据用户的网络状况,动态调整直播流的路由。当检测到用户网络波动时,系统会自动切换到更稳定的线路,从而降低网络波动对画质的影响。
动态码率适配技术(Dynamic Rate Adaptation,DRA)是CDN直播中常用的一种技术。该技术可以根据用户的网络状况,实时调整直播流的码率,确保画质在波动时仍能保持稳定。
丢包补偿技术(Packet Loss Compensation,PLC)可以通过预测丢失的数据包,并在后续的数据中填充,从而降低丢包对画质的影响。
边缘计算技术将计算能力下沉到网络边缘,减少数据传输距离,降低延迟。在CDN直播中,边缘计算技术可以提高直播的流畅性,降低网络波动对画质的影响。
缓存优化技术通过优化CDN节点的缓存策略,提高直播内容的缓存命中率,减少网络请求,降低网络波动对画质的影响。
智能调度技术可以根据用户的网络状况,动态调整直播流的服务器负载,确保直播服务在波动时仍能保持稳定。
三、总结
CDN直播技术在应对网络波动对画质的影响方面,已取得显著成果。通过智能选路、动态码率适配、丢包补偿、边缘计算、缓存优化和智能调度等技术,CDN直播可以有效降低网络波动对画质的影响,为用户提供流畅、高质量的直播体验。随着技术的不断进步,CDN直播在应对网络波动方面的能力将更加出色。
猜你喜欢:直播api开放接口
更多热门资讯